Valley Village Vibe Check

Valley Village is a quiet residential pocket between Studio City and North Hollywood -- tree-lined streets, modest mid-century homes, and a growing restaurant scene along Burbank Blvd give it a neighborhood charm. It's the Valley's version of a hidden gem.

QuietCharmingResidentialMid-RangeHidden Gem
